17. RESOURCE SHARING
A major benefit of scientific research is its potential translation for the benefit of human health. Rapid
sharing of scientific data and reagents/resources can potentially reduce the time between a discovery and
the effective "translation" of that discovery. Scientific publications are the major mechanism for sharing data
with other scientists and with the public at large. WHP-San Francisco investigators will make their
published work available to interested scientists by submitting an electronic version of their paper to the
National Library of Medicine's PubMed Central upon acceptance for publication. These papers will be
made publicly available no later than 12 months after the official date of publication in accord with NIH
Public Access Policy (NOT-OD-05-022). Similarly, reagents utilized in these publications will be made
freely available to other academic investigators in a timely manner. The sharing of data and resources
serves the best interest of overall scientific progress. When appropriate, patent protection may be sought
for discoveries that may have commercial value. However, patenting procedures should not preclude the
distribution of information or reagents to interested academic investigators, as outlined in the NIH
Guidelines for Dissemination of Research Resources Arising Out of NIH-funded Research. WHP-San
Francisco is dedicated to establishing the appropriate policies and procedures as a well as a culture for
effective sharing of data and resources.
